Description
In this demonstration, an Ethernet-controlled GPIO interface application uses the ML40x
board as a Web server. A remote host, such as a PC running a Web browser, can
communicate with the ML40x board using the Ethernet to read the value of the ML40x
board's DIP switches or to set the LEDs on the board. Refreshing or reloading the remote
PC's Web browser causes the background color to change and the current DIP switch
values to be re-read. By default, the IP address of the ML40x board is 1.2.3.4, but it can be
changed by recompiling the software.

Connect an Ethernet cable (straight or crossover) from your host PC to the ML40x
board.
Note:
The Ethernet PHY chip on the ML40x board has an auto-crossover feature.
Configure the remote PC host's IP address to 1.2.3.9 (Subnet mask can be 255.0.0.0).
